After looking at a post on another forum it becomes apparent that there are quite a few timetable changes for buses in and around Bristol coming in the next couple of weeks. So far I am aware of:

Bristol:
- Service 5 (Downend - Bromley Heath - Fishponds - City Centre) will no longer serve Bromley Heath and will now run a more direct route, with shorter journey times, between Downend and Oldbury Court.

Following a round of retendering of service contracts:
- Service 12 (Cribbs Causeway - Severn Beach) will be run by First on Sundays & Bank Hols.
- Service 622 (Chipping Sodbury - Cribbs Causeway) will be run by First on Sundays & Bank Hols.
- Services 663-665 (Keynsham area) will pass from HCT to Stagecoach
- Service 672 (Blagdon - Bristol) will be operated by Eurotaxis, HCT withdrawing, with only 2 journeys each way per day rather than the present 5.

I have heard elsewhere that Service 17 (Southmead Hospital - Keynsham) is to be split following a retendering exercise with one part being renumbered as Service 16. I am sure I have seen it suggested that Stagecoach will be operating the 16 but I cannot find anything to confirm this.

Weston-s-Mare & North Somerset:
Services X1-X7 are slightly retimed. In addition:

- Service X9 (Nailsea - Bristol) is reduced in daytime frequency on Mondays to Saturdays with journeys now running every 90 minutes rather than every 30 minutes. The hourly evening service is maintained. Also, on Sundays and Bank Holidays, the 30-minute frequency is reduced to one every 90 minutes with later starts from both ends of the route.

With the town services in Weston-super-Mare, Services 1-6 are unchanged.
- Service 7 (Oldmixon & Haywood) is increased in frequency at peak times but is otherwise unchanged.
